✅ SHOP NOTES: That's right, your Shopsmith has a hair trigger that ideally you'll be able to avoid, but if your quill return spring breaks or if the depth gauge gets out of alignment, you might not have a choice but to tempt fate. Ok, I'm being overly dramatic. Yes, you do need to approach this carefully, but it's totally doing about and you've got this!
